Abstract
The review is based on the works by employees of the Grebenshchikov Institute of Silicate Chemistry of the Russian Academy of Sciences (RAS). Approaches to the formation of glass-ceramic coatings on graphite have been considered from preliminarily molten glass and filler, from the mixture of initial components not containing glass during synthesis, and from silicon- and boron-containing compounds yielding a glass-forming melt upon thermal treatment in air. These works served as the basis for creating coatings of a new type.
